MLB Picks and Predictions for Monday, September 15, 2014

Toronto Blue Jays vs. Baltimore Orioles (7:05 PM ET)

Line: Toronto Blue Jays (+115) at Baltimore Orioles (-125); total: 7.5 – see all MLB lines

[sc:MLB240banner ]Comfortably ahead of the Blue Jays by 11.5 games for the American League East title, the Orioles can reduce their magic number to one when they start Wei-Yin Chen (15-4, 3.59 ERA) in the first game of this season’s penultimate series between Baltimore and Toronto.

The Orioles are 4-0 in Chen’s last four home starts. The Blue Jays, on the other hand, will go with Marcus Stroman (10-5, 3.61 ERA). Stroman is 3-0 and has an ERA mark of 1.59 over his last three starts. Stroman was rock solid in his last outing, throwing a complete-game three-hitter in the Blue Jays’ 8-0 victory against the Chicago Cubs on September 8.

Writer’s prediction: Toronto wins.

Washington Nationals vs. Atlanta Braves (7:10 PM ET)

Line: Washington Nationals (-118) Atlanta Braves (+108); total: 6.5– see all MLB lines

Although the Braves are 1-6 in their last seven games, a loss at home with Ervin Santana (14-8, 3.76 ERA) on the mound remains an alien concept to the team’s fans. The Braves are 8-0 in Santana’s last eight starts at Turner Field and over that stretch, the Dominican pitcher went 7-0 with a 2.91 ERA. Santana will be matched up tonight against the Nationals’ fireballer, Stephen Strasburg (11-11, 3.46 ERA). Strasburg has a 2-0 record and a 0.61 ERA in his last two road starts.

Writer’s prediction: Nats’ win, blemish Santana’s record.

New York Yankees vs. Tampa Bay Rays (7:10 PM ET)

Line: New York Yankees (+120) at Tampa Bay Rays (-130); total: 8.0 – see all MLB lines

The Rays, who are 4-1 in their last five games against a lefty starter, would probably be happy to see the Yankees’ Chris Capuano on the mound later. Tampa Bay massacred Capuano in their meeting last week, tagging the left-hander with four runs in the first inning, albeit in an 8-5 loss.

Despite the disastrous outing by Capuano, the Yankees are undefeated in the pitcher’s last four starts overall. Facing the Yankees is Alex Colome (1-0, 2.79 ERA), who will make his fifth career start tonight. Colome’s only win thus far this season came in the Rays’ 5-2 win over Baltimore on June 27, when he gave up just an earned run in 5.2 innings of duty.

Writer’s prediction: New York wins.

Cleveland Indians vs. Houston Astros (8:10 PM ET)

Line: Cleveland Indians at Houston Astros – see all MLB lines

Collin McHugh (9-9, 2.79 ERA) has been unstoppable in his recent starts, and his presence on the mound tonight for the Astros is not a pretty sight for Cleveland, which is in dire need of wins for a last push for a postseason spot. The Astros are 6-1 in McHugh’s last seven starts, wherein he did not allow more than two earned runs in any of those games. The Indians, however, have dominated Houston since last season. They are 8-2 in their last 10 games against the Astros.

Writer’s prediction: Cleveland wins.

Seattle Mariners vs. Los Angeles Angels (10:05 PM ET)

Line: Seattle Mariners (+114) at Los Angeles Angels (-124); total: 7.5– see all MLB lines

Hisashi Iwakuma

Los Angeles could lock in a postseason spot with a win tonight against the visiting Mariners. After losing 6-1 to the lowly Astros yesterday, the Angels will send to the mound Matt Shoemaker (15-4, 3.16 ERA), who is 6-0 with a 1.32 ERA over his last seven outings. He’ll be in for a duel with Seattle’s Hisashi Iwakuma (14-7, 3.11), who’ll bring a 5-0 record with a 1.75 ERA in seven career starts against the Angels. The Mariners are 10-2 record in Iwakuma’s last 12 road starts.

Writer’s prediction: Seattle wins.
